Personalized Service

The essence of a luxury bed and breakfast lies in its ability to anticipate and fulfill guest needs in ways that feel personalized, never scripted. From customizing breakfast menus to crafting itineraries that reflect individual tastes, every thoughtful gesture reinforces a sense of belonging. Personalized service often begins even before check-in by reaching out to guests to gather preferences or special requests, and continues throughout the stay with attentive yet unobtrusive care. Remembered names, favorite hot beverages upon arrival, and hand-written notes set a standard that large hotels struggle to emulate.

Room Design and Comfort

Luxury accommodations are defined by exceptional comfort, which begins with investing in the finest mattresses, plush bedding, and immaculate linens. Elegant yet inviting room design, featuring distinctive furnishings and artistic touches, creates an environment where guests immediately feel at ease. Integrating elements that reflect the building’s history or the local culture can further deepen guests’ appreciation of their surroundings. According to hospitality experts, well-chosen decor and thoughtful room amenities turn “something you enter into something you experience”.

Amenities and Extras

Going above and beyond with high-end amenities is essential at a luxury property. Spa services, private soaking tubs, and curated welcome baskets offer comfort and delight, while branded robes and slippers add subtle refinement to the guest journey. Guests may also appreciate a selection of complimentary drinks and snacks or evening desserts awaiting them upon return from a day of exploration. Providing thoughtful extras, such as locally made gifts or branded keepsakes, allows guests to take a piece of the experience home. Culinary Experiences

One of the primary delights of any bed and breakfast is breakfast itself. Gourmet offerings crafted from locally sourced ingredients showcase regional flavors and give guests a sense of place. Creative takes on classic recipes, farm-fresh produce, and fresh-baked pastries add excitement to the morning meal. Some luxury properties go further by accommodating dietary preferences, offering wine-and-cheese hours, or collaborating with local chefs for special events. The culinary program becomes not just a meal, but a highlight of the stay and a reason to return.

Attention to Detail

It is often the most minor touches that make the most significant impression on guests. A signature scent flowing throughout common areas, fresh flowers in each room, or welcome notes written by hand demonstrate genuine care. Little luxuries such as high-end toiletries, heated bathroom floors, and perfectly appointed reading nooks also set a luxury bed and breakfast apart. These thoughtful gestures show hosts are committed to excellence in every aspect of the guest experience and inspire guests to share their positive memories with others.
